The Fotona 4D laser delivers controlled laser energy into multiple layers of the skin to stimulate collagen production and encourage tissue tightening. This heat stimulates fibroblasts (the cells responsible for producing collagen), improving skin firmness, smoothing fine lines, and refining overall texture.
The exact laser wavelength used depends on the targeted conditions. Our device uses two laser wavelengths: Nd:YAG and Er:YAG.
- Nd:YAG: Fotona’s Nd:YAG laser technology can handle a wide range of aesthetic treatments in large areas. The thermal energy from the laser penetrates the skin to precisely target even the deepest skin structures.
- Er:YAG: Designed to treat surface-level skin irregularities, the Er:YAG laser technology allows for precise, layer-by-layer dermal ablation. This process causes skin cells to shrink, stimulates collagen production, and promotes healthier skin overall.
